2018–19 Rio Ave F.C. season

The 2018–19 season is Rio Ave's eleventh season back in the Primeira Liga.

Season events edit

During the pre-season, manager Miguel Cardoso resigned on 13 June 2018,[1] with José Gomes being appointed as his replacement the same day.[2] Six months later, 22 December 2018, Gomes resigned to take the vacant manager's position at English Championship club Reading,[3] with Daniel Ramos being appointed as his replacement on 1 January 2019.[4]
